Housing in Hayfield sits 114% above the national median — $654,000 for the typical home — but median household incomes near $192,813 (159% above the US figure) soften the blow that similar pricing creates in lower-wage metros.

Located 5 miles southwest of Alexandria, Hayfield falls within that metro's commuting orbit. Housing prices track closely with Alexandria's $697,000 median.

About the Cost of Living in Hayfield

The median home value in Hayfield is $653,700 — 114% above the national median of $305,000. Median rent runs $3,277/month, 149% higher than the national median of $1,314/month. The median household income of $192,813/year is 159% higher than the US median of $74,580. The local unemployment rate is 3.4%, below the national average of 4.8%. Virginia's top state income tax rate is 5.8% and the combined sales tax is 5.6%. The climate averages highs of 67.8°F and lows of 50.9°F, with about 13.7" of annual snowfall. Overall, Hayfield has a cost of living index of 228 versus the US average of 100, meaning it is 128% more expensive.
